“Nothing but Praise” for Whitstone School During Pandemic

The latest Whitstone School survey shows that parents are delighted with the way the School is performing during the COVID-19 Pandemic.

The survey was sent to all of our students’ parents, asking their opinions of how the School is performing with delivering online learning, school to home communication and student safety. 

Headteacher, Mr Swallow says: “Thank you to everyone who took the time to respond - we have had some very supportive replies from parents, which is a huge boost to the teaching and support staff here, who are all working extremely hard to deliver the highest standard of education to our students, whilst also keeping them safe. The response from parents has been overwhelmingly positive”

One parent wrote: “(We have) nothing but praise for an amazing school and equally amazing staff who has made my sons first few months so good. Stay safe and thanks so much to each and every one of you for your hard work.”

Another says: “Excellent teachers who provide great quality teaching who have been there for the children and the parents throughout this difficult time.”

When asked specifically to rate the quality of online learning provision, 9/10 parents rated it either very good or excellent.

One parent says: “We couldn't be more pleased with how excited and interested our child is in his learning.”

Parents also seem very happy with the quality of communication from the school, with 9/10 rating the School’s communication during the pandemic as at least ‘very good’.

Whitstone School’s safety measures also scored very highly, with 100% of parents saying they feel their child is kept safe by staff at school.

In response to feedback to the survey we have decided to investigate ways to make some of our lessons even more creative and practical.  We are also looking at ways of providing more feedback to parents and students about the work being submitted.  We will update parents on this as soon as we are able to.

The survey responses were full of praise.  More of the positive comments from parents include:

 “We are more than happy with the education our children are receiving at Whitstone.  They are both doing really well there so far, despite the disruption of the pandemic. Well done Whitstone!!”

Mr Swallow comments: “We are very fortunate to have such a supportive school community.  Parents and carers are doing a brilliant job at home, helping their children with their studies.  Still, we are very much looking forward to having the students back in school as soon as it is safe to do so, so that we can continue to give them the best quality education that they deserve.”
